Stefan Ratchford has signed a two-year extension to his Warrington contract.

The England full-back had one more full season to run on his previous deal but is now under contract until November 2020.

Ratchford has scored 550 points in 160 games since arriving from Salford in 2012 and earned a first England cap in the autumn.

He said: "I'm delighted to get this over the line. I was heading into the last year of my deal next year and didn't know what was to happen so I'm delighted that the club has chosen to extend my contract.

"The next few years are exciting with the young lads coming through and the current squad we have. The club is continuing to grow off the field as well as on it and hopefully, in the not too distant future, we can finally pick up that elusive Grand Final winners ring and achieve the goals we've set out for."

Head coach Tony Smith said: "I'm delighted for Stef on his extension. He has been very consistent this year and has earned the right for a longer term deal.

"He was already on contract for next year, but is mature enough with the right sort of temperament for us to extend his contract further. He works hard and is a good leader within our group."

Front rower Joe Philbin has also signed a two-year deal on the back of 12 appearances so far this season.

"I've come all the way through from the juniors on the progression ladder at Warrington," said Philbin, who is now under contract until 2019. "When they came to me to re-sign it was a pretty simple decision to make.

"I struggled to get game time last year but got a little bit of a run at the back end of the season just missing out on the Grand Final but that's made me more hungry for this year. I'm happy to be getting more game time now and playing with a smile on my face, playing my game."
